Introducing a NEW UX maturity Metric: The Team Engagement Score (TES) During Usability Testing

Product team engagement during usability testing is a critical aspect of creating a great UX, as well as helping an organization move up the UX maturity ladder. The presenters will introduce a new metric called the Team Engagement Score (TES) , which strives to benchmark team and stakeholder buy-in and participation during the usability testing process. TES emphasizes the significant role that observation plays in communicating the significance of usability issues to team members during testing sessions. TES comprises three important elements: teams’ commitment, prioritization, and involvement in the observation of usability sessions. The presenter’s will demonstrate how to calculate TES for a variety of common scenarios and different ways it can be used within an organization. TES also moves the UX community towards a more measurable definition of UX maturity.
